16 Mar (Sat): Guided Walk of Chinatown Heritage Tree Trail

Located in the Central region of the city, Chinatown is the largest historic district in Singapore and is home to several Heritage Trees.
Join us on a tour around the area to get up close with the Bodhi Tree (Ficus religiosa), a tree closely associated with Hinduism and Buddhism, and learn about a native mango, the Binjai (Mangifera caesia), which produces curious potato-like fruit. Find out the fascinating stories behind these Heritage Trees as well as the interesting plants in the area!
